i love love love my p5.... its style lets you build it to your style... in other words no 2 p5 look alike.... the one and only down fall is the top speed of 38-40 mph.... but this is never a problem on the trails...never.... the p5 keeps up and even leads the pack in the trail.... only riding on dirt roads does this matter....and for my riding this is not a factor....again i love my p5 with no regets

Thanks @admin for putting this in the right section. P500 :)

The more I drive this P500 the more impressed I am with how maneuverable it is through the trees, just seems to finesse through them while inspiring confidence from my last 50" SxS (RZR800) even though the P500 seat is 5 inches higher it doesn't fell like the COG is much if any different and the view is much better from sitting higher.

Glad to have input from an owner of both. I have had limited time in a RZR, but went with the P500 on the merits of compression/engine braking alone. I've always been a fan of groundspeed control, that's probably why I like manual transmissions in Jeeps, working vehicles, etc.
